The Rundown

Bethune-Cookman travels to Orlando to open the season against UCF at the Acrisure Bounce House, with kickoff set for 7 PM local time. The Knights are massive 38.5-point favorites, a number that reflects the raw talent gap between a Power conference program and an FCS opponent. The total sits at 55.5, suggesting oddsmakers expect UCF to move the ball freely while Bethune-Cookman likely contributes modest offensive output. The moneyline tells the real story — UCF is priced at -100000, making this as close to a certainty as sportsbooks will post, while the Wildcats check in at +8000 for any bettors chasing a miracle. Neither side of the spread nor the total has seen meaningful movement since the line opened, which is notable on its own. The market has looked at this one, shrugged, and moved on — sharp money simply has no reason to argue with a number this wide.
